Latest Patents
One of his latest innovations is a recyclable coffee cup with an integrated lid. This disposable cup is designed to be unitarily formed from wood, cellulosic, or other fiber pulp-based materials. The unique aspect of this cup is that it can be recycled using a single recycling process, unlike conventional disposable cups that often require separation into various components for recycling. This innovation not only simplifies the recycling process but also promotes sustainability by reducing waste.
